Might Gonzalez need a day off now?
"In my eyes, there are two options," Gonzalez said. "Either don't play the entire series in San Francisco or let me grind it out.
"I've never believed one day off is going to change anything. So those are the only two options I see worth anything. Two days, no."
Is Gonzalez tired?
"Physically, no," he said. "Mentally, yes.
